* [PATCH v7] Add payload to be 32-bit aligned to fix dropped packets
@ 2021-11-18 15:33 Kumar Thangavel
0 siblings, 0 replies; 5+ messages in thread
From: Kumar Thangavel @ 2021-11-18 15:33 UTC (permalink / raw)
To: Samuel Mendoza-Jonas, David S. Miller, Jakub Kicinski
Cc: openbmc, linux-aspeed, netdev, patrickw3, Amithash Prasad,
sdasari, velumanit
Update NC-SI command handler (both standard and OEM) to take into
account of payload paddings in allocating skb (in case of payload
size is not 32-bit aligned).
The checksum field follows payload field, without taking payload
padding into account can cause checksum being truncated, leading to
dropped packets.
Fixes: fb4ee67529ff ("net/ncsi: Add NCSI OEM command support")
Signed-off-by: Kumar Thangavel <thangavel.k@hcl.com>
Acked-by: Samuel Mendoza-Jonas <sam@mendozajonas.com>
Reviewed-by: Paul Menzel <pmenzel@molgen.mpg.de>

net/ncsi/ncsi-cmd.c | 24 ++++++++++++++++--------
1 file changed, 16 insertions(+), 8 deletions(-)
diff --git a/net/ncsi/ncsi-cmd.c b/net/ncsi/ncsi-cmd.c
index ba9ae482141b..9a6f10f4833e 100644
--- a/net/ncsi/ncsi-cmd.c
+++ b/net/ncsi/ncsi-cmd.c
@@ -18,6 +18,8 @@
#include "internal.h"
#include "ncsi-pkt.h"
+const static int padding_bytes = 26;
+
u32 ncsi_calculate_checksum(unsigned char *data, int len)
{
u32 checksum = 0;
@@ -213,12 +215,17 @@ static int ncsi_cmd_handler_oem(struct sk_buff *skb,
{
struct ncsi_cmd_oem_pkt *cmd;
unsigned int len;
+ int payload;
+ /* NC-SI spec DSP_0222_1.2.0, section 8.2.2.2
+ * requires payload to be padded with 0 to
+ * 32-bit boundary before the checksum field.
+ * Ensure the padding bytes are accounted for in
+ * skb allocation
+ */
+ payload = ALIGN(nca->payload, 4);
len = sizeof(struct ncsi_cmd_pkt_hdr) + 4;
- if (nca->payload < 26)
- len += 26;
- else
- len += nca->payload;
+ len += max(payload, padding_bytes);
cmd = skb_put_zero(skb, len);
memcpy(&cmd->mfr_id, nca->data, nca->payload);
@@ -272,6 +279,7 @@ static struct ncsi_request *ncsi_alloc_command(struct ncsi_cmd_arg *nca)
struct net_device *dev = nd->dev;
int hlen = LL_RESERVED_SPACE(dev);
int tlen = dev->needed_tailroom;
+ int payload;
int len = hlen + tlen;
struct sk_buff *skb;
struct ncsi_request *nr;
@@ -281,14 +289,14 @@ static struct ncsi_request *ncsi_alloc_command(struct ncsi_cmd_arg *nca)
return NULL;
/* NCSI command packet has 16-bytes header, payload, 4 bytes checksum.
+ * Payload needs padding so that the checksum field following payload is
+ * aligned to 32-bit boundary.
* The packet needs padding if its payload is less than 26 bytes to
* meet 64 bytes minimal ethernet frame length.
*/
len += sizeof(struct ncsi_cmd_pkt_hdr) + 4;
- if (nca->payload < 26)
- len += 26;
- else
- len += nca->payload;
+ payload = ALIGN(nca->payload, 4);
+ len += max(payload, padding_bytes);
/* Allocate skb */
skb = alloc_skb(len, GFP_ATOMIC);
